Champions League and European Fixtures
When PSG competes in the UEFA Champions League or the Europa League, the stakes and the viewing times become even more critical. European matches usually take place on Tuesday or Wednesday nights. For these fixtures, the what time does PSG play is generally aligned with the prime-time slots in Central European Time, often kicking off around 21:00. This scheduling accommodates broadcasters across the continent, ensuring maximum exposure for the club on the continental stage.
Cup Competitions and Timing Variations
Domestic cup competitions add another layer to the fixture list. Matches in the Coupe de France or Coupe de la Ligue can occur on various days, including midweek. The what time does PSG play in these knockout ties is subject to change based on television rights and the specific round of the competition. Unlike the relative consistency of the league, cup schedules can be more fluid, requiring fans to check updates closer to the match date to confirm the exact kick-off.
